For starters, shedding excess weight can have a positive effect on your heart health. Obese individuals are at increased risk for heart-related issues like coronary artery disease or stroke. Losing weight can reduce the strain on your heart, and lower your blood cholesterol and triglycerides, which can help to decrease your risk of heart-related conditions.
Similarly, weight loss can improve your respiratory health. If you're overweight, you are more likely to suffer from diseases like asthma or sleep apnea. Losing weight can reduce the severity of these respiratory issues, allowing you to breathe more easily.
Weight loss is also beneficial for your joints and muscles. People who are overweight or obese place an excessive amount of stress on their joints and muscles, which can lead to chronic pain, joint damage, and mobility issues. By dropping a few pounds, you can reduce the amount of stress on your joints and allow your muscles to become stronger.
